About The Artwork

This is a set of three family members. Tron Conger is the father and a scientist. They travel the galaxy together as he studies the effects of the modification of gravity on a local scale. Annabelle is Trons wife and Soarys mom. Some people puzzle over her unusual "looks", but that’s just because she’s happy all the time. Of course Soary is the daughter. She's a bit precocious, but also shy and kind like her parents. I started each of them with a brass frame and attached aluminum screen and then applied cement until they were them. The cement is seal coated. Their eyes, teeth and hair are silver. I drilled many tiny holes in the cement and inserted each strand of "hair" into these holes. The teeth are embedded in the gums just like mine. They are securely fastened to their wooden bases. I can’t allow the family to be split up so you have to take them all or none.

I try to create what the eye could never see in real life, but that which could still be real in some ways. To stimulate the viewer’s imagination and pull things forward in the mind, I am a viewer, also. I seek balance. I use color and form to get there. Art is my aeroplane and color lifts my wings. Being an artist is not my primary occupation, but I’ve been producing art since I was a child. I seem to be driven to create - not just art but about everything in my life. There’s a saying that fits me pretty good. It goes like this. Most people, when asked, would say their destination is back home. My destination is forward.
